Heeeeere’s Jaaaaan , “And yes, when we find illegal workers, yes, appropriate action, some of which is criminal, most of that is civil, because crossing the border is not a crime per se. It is civil. But anyway, going after those as well.”

She made this characteristic display of brilliance on the show of the equally brilliant Larry King, he who has sired the ” my son told me he wants to be black because blacks have all the advantages” male yenta , and no the latter didn’t call her on it, but Julie Kirchner, Executive Director of FAIR sure did:

ENTRY WITHOUT INSPECTION IS A CRIME: In fact, pursuant to 8 U.S.C. 1325, crossing the border illegally is a crime–a misdemeanor for the first offense and a felony for the second and subsequent offenses.
